Delhi Riots Case: Former AAP Councillor Tahir Hussain Convicted in IB Officer Ankit Sharma Murder Case
A Delhi court has convicted former AAP councillor Tahir Hussain and four others* in the murder of Intelligence Bureau officer Ankit Sharma during the riots in North-East Delhi in 2020.
The verdict came Wednesday, over five years after the violence. The court shall pronounce the quantum of sentence in due course.

It was one of the most closely watched trials about the communal violence in northeast Delhi in February 2020.
How the Incident Developed
Ankit Sharma, a 26-year-old IB officer, was among those killed in the riots that broke out in North-East Delhi.
His body was found days after the violence in a drain in Chand Bagh. It was one of the most talked-about deaths to have come out of the riots and led to an in-depth probe by Delhi Police. To be decided later. The court has pronounced the conviction, while the quantum of punishment will be decided in a separate hearing.
Both sides will submit arguments on sentencing before the court decides how long to jail the convicted.
